We successfully manufactured a precision 6061 aluminum automation slider component for an industrial automation system application. This critical linear motion component features precision-machined bearing seats and mounting interfaces, finished with a durable black anodized coating for enhanced wear resistance and corrosion protection in demanding automation environments.
| Project Name | 6061 Aluminum Automation Slider Component |
| Key Metric | Specification |
| Dimensional Tolerance | ±0.015mm (bearing seats and guide surfaces) |
| Material | Aluminum 6061-T6 |
| Surface Treatment | Black Anodizing (MIL-A-8625 Type II) |
| Surface Roughness | Ra≤1.6μm (bearing seat surfaces) |
| Machining Process | Precision CNC milling |
Each component underwent comprehensive inspection using CMM measurement for dimensional accuracy (±0.015mm on critical bearing seats), supplemented by surface roughness testing (Ra≤1.6μm) and anodized coating verification.
